While the process may seem complicated, septic installation follows a structured series of steps designed to protect your property, groundwater, and long-term system performance. Understanding how septic systems are installed can help homeowners prepare for the project and ensure the system functions properly for decades. Step 1: Site Evaluation and Soil Testing Before installation begins, the property must undergo a site evaluation to determine if the land can support a septic system. A professional will evaluate: Soil composition Drainage capability (percolation rate) Groundwater levels Property slope Distance from wells, homes, and property lines Soil testing is extremely important because the soil acts as part of the wastewater treatment process. Some soil types absorb water well, while others require specialized systems such as aerobic treatment units or modified drain fields. Step 2: Septic System Design and Permits After the evaluation, a septic system design is created based on: Number of bedrooms in the home Estimated daily water usage Soil test results Local health regulations Property layout Most regions require permits through local environmental or health departments before installation can begin. This ensures the system meets safety and environmental standards. Permitting may take several days or several weeks depending on the area. Step 3: Excavation and Tank Placement Once permits are approved, the installation crew begins excavation. During this stage: The tank location is dug using excavation equipment Trenches or spray areas are prepared Underground plumbing lines are installed The septic tank is then carefully lowered into the excavated space and leveled to ensure proper wastewater flow. For many systems, multiple tanks may be installed, such as: Trash tank (initial solids separation) Treatment tank Pump tank Proper placement is critical because uneven tanks can interfere with floats and pumps. Step 4: Installing System Components Depending on the system type, additional components may be installed. Conventional Septic Systems These systems typically include: Septic tank Distribution box Drain field trenches Wastewater flows by gravity into underground perforated pipes that disperse treated water into the soil. Step 5: Inspection and System Testing Before the system is covered with soil, inspectors verify that everything meets local regulations. The inspection may check: Tank placement Pipe slope and connections Pump operation Electrical components System layout Once approved, the system is tested to ensure pumps, floats, aerators, and alarms operate correctly. Step 6: Backfilling and Final Grading After inspection and testing, the excavated areas are backfilled and leveled. During this phase: Soil is replaced around tanks and trenches Access lids are adjusted to proper height Spray heads (for aerobic systems) are tested The yard is restored as much as possible Homeowners should avoid driving vehicles over the installation area until the soil has fully settled. How Long Does Septic Installation Take? Most residential septic systems can be installed in one to three days once permits and planning are complete. However, the full timeline may include: Soil testing Permit approvals System design Scheduling equipment and crew The entire process from planning to completion can take several weeks. What Homeowners Should Expect During Installation Septic installation is a construction project, so some temporary disruption is normal. Homeowners should expect: Heavy equipment on the property Excavation in the yard Noise from machinery Temporary landscaping disturbance These disruptions are temporary and necessary for proper system installation. Maintaining Your Septic System After Installation Once the system is installed, proper maintenance is essential for long-term reliability. Homeowners should: Pump the septic tank every 3–5 years Avoid flushing wipes, grease, or chemicals Monitor alarms on aerobic systems Schedule routine inspections Regular maintenance prevents costly repairs and protects the drain field.
